I would encourage you to check out ARMA International. They have a
topic area on Electronic Records and offer many helpful books in their
bookstore. The ARMA bookstore has two books specific to small business:
'Organize Your Office: A Small Business Survival Guide to Managing
Records' and 'At Your Fingertips in the Office: Information Management
for the Small Business'.
